* Support multiple filers for S3 and IAM servers with automatic failover This change adds support for multiple filer addresses in the 'weed s3' and 'weed iam' commands, enabling high availability through automatic failover. Key changes: - Updated S3ApiServerOption.Filer to Filers ([]pb.ServerAddress) - Updated IamServerOption.Filer to Filers ([]pb.ServerAddress) - Modified -filer flag to accept comma-separated addresses - Added getFilerAddress() helper methods for backward compatibility - Updated all filer client calls to support multiple addresses - Uses pb.WithOneOfGrpcFilerClients for automatic failover Usage: weed s3 -filer=localhost:8888,localhost:8889 weed iam -filer=localhost:8888,localhost:8889 The underlying FilerClient already supported multiple filers with health tracking and automatic failover - this change exposes that capability through the command-line interface. * Add filer discovery: treat initial filers as seeds and discover peers from master Enhances FilerClient to automatically discover additional filers in the same filer group by querying the master server. This allows users to specify just a few seed filers, and the client will discover all other filers in the cluster. Key changes to wdclient/FilerClient: - Added MasterClient, FilerGroup, and DiscoveryInterval fields - Added thread-safe filer list management with RWMutex - Implemented discoverFilers() background goroutine - Uses cluster.ListExistingPeerUpdates() to query master for filers - Automatically adds newly discovered filers to the list - Added Close() method to clean up discovery goroutine New FilerClientOption fields: - MasterClient: enables filer discovery from master - FilerGroup: specifies which filer group to discover - DiscoveryInterval: how often to refresh (default 5 minutes) Usage example: masterClient := wdclient.NewMasterClient(...) filerClient := wdclient.NewFilerClient( []pb.ServerAddress{"localhost:8888"}, // seed filers grpcDialOption, dataCenter, &wdclient.FilerClientOption{ MasterClient: masterClient, FilerGroup: "my-group", }, ) defer filerClient.Close() The initial filers act as seeds - the client discovers and adds all other filers in the same group from the master. URL escaping was needed when the path was embedded in a URL (old toFilerUrl), but now that we pass paths directly to putToFiler, they should be unescaped. This fixes S3 integration test failures: - test_bucket_listv2_encoding_basic - test_bucket_list_encoding_basic - test_bucket_listv2_delimiter_whitespace - test_bucket_list_delimiter_whitespace The tests were failing because paths were double-encoded (escaped when stored, then escaped again when listed), resulting in %252B instead of %2B for '+' characters. Root cause: When we removed URL parsing in putToFiler, we should have also removed URL escaping in toFilerPath since paths are now used directly without URL encoding/decoding. * Add thread safety to FilerEtcStore and clarify credential store comments Address review suggestions for better thread safety and code clarity: 1. **Thread Safety**: Add RWMutex to FilerEtcStore - Protects filerAddressFunc and grpcDialOption from concurrent access - Initialize() uses write lock when setting function - SetFilerAddressFunc() uses write lock - withFilerClient() uses read lock to get function and dial option - GetPolicies() uses read lock to check if configured 2. **Improved Error Messages**: - Prefix errors with "filer_etc:" for easier debugging - "filer address not configured" → "filer_etc: filer address function not configured" - "filer address is empty" → "filer_etc: filer address is empty" 3. **Clarified Comments**: - auth_credentials.go: Clarify that initial setup is temporary - Document that it's updated in s3api_server.go after FilerClient creation - Remove ambiguity about when FilerClient.GetCurrentFiler is used Benefits: - Safe for concurrent credential operations - Clear error messages for debugging - Explicit documentation of initialization order * Enable filer discovery: pass master addresses to FilerClient Fix two critical issues: 1. **Filer Discovery Not Working**: Master client was not being passed to FilerClient, so peer discovery couldn't work 2. **Credential Store Design**: Already uses FilerClient via GetCurrentFiler function - this is the correct design for HA Changes: **Command (s3.go):** - Read master addresses from GetFilerConfiguration response - Pass masterAddresses to S3ApiServerOption - Log master addresses for visibility **S3ApiServerOption:** - Add Masters []pb.ServerAddress field for discovery **S3ApiServer:** - Create MasterClient from Masters when available - Pass MasterClient + FilerGroup to FilerClient via options - Enable discovery with 5-minute refresh interval - Log whether discovery is enabled or disabled **Credential Store:** - Already correctly uses filerClient.GetCurrentFiler via function - This provides HA without tight coupling to FilerClient struct - Function-based design is clean and thread-safe Discovery Flow: 1. * fix listing objects * add more list testing * address comments * fix next marker * fix isTruncated in listing * fix tests * address tests * Update s3api_object_handlers_multipart.go * fixes * store json into bucket content, for tagging and cors * switch bucket metadata from json to proto * fix * Update s3api_bucket_config.go * fix test issue * fix test_bucket_listv2_delimiter_prefix * Update cors.go * skip special characters * passing listing * fix test_bucket_list_delimiter_prefix * ok. fix the xsd generated go code now * fix cors tests * fix test * fix test_bucket_list_unordered and test_bucket_listv2_unordered do not accept the allow-unordered and delimiter parameter combination * fix test_bucket_list_objects_anonymous and test_bucket_listv2_objects_anonymous The tests test_bucket_list_objects_anonymous and test_bucket_listv2_objects_anonymous were failing because they try to set bucket ACL to public-read, but SeaweedFS only supported private ACL. Updated PutBucketAclHandler to use the existing ExtractAcl function which already supports all standard S3 canned ACLs Replaced the hardcoded check for only private ACL with proper ACL parsing that handles public-read, public-read-write, authenticated-read, bucket-owner-read, bucket-owner-full-control, etc. Added unit tests to verify all standard canned ACLs are accepted * fix list unordered The test is expecting the error code to be InvalidArgument instead of InvalidRequest * allow anonymous listing( and head, get) * fix test_bucket_list_maxkeys_invalid Invalid values: max-keys=blah → Returns ErrInvalidMaxKeys (HTTP 400) * updating IsPublicRead when parsing acl * more logs * CORS Test Fix * fix test_bucket_list_return_data * default to private * fix test_bucket_list_delimiter_not_skip_special * default no acl * add debug logging * more logs * use basic http client remove logs also * fixes * debug * Update stats.go * debugging * fix anonymous test expectation anonymous user can read, as configured in s3 json.
